Introduction: The Evolution of Online Gambling Features

Online gambling has undergone a remarkable transformation over the past decade. Traditional slot machines and betting exchanges have been supplemented—or in some cases, replaced—by features that mimic video games’ interactive and motivational elements. These developments are driven by a desire to increase retention, incentivize responsible play, and attract a broader demographic.

Two innovative features have garnered significant attention among industry leaders:

  • Gamble-Funktion: Provides players with options to double or risk their winnings through strategic choices.
  • Risikoleiter: A risk ladder mechanism that visually indicates the level of risk the player takes, often embedded within a gamified interface.

Gamification: Beyond Traditional Betting

Gamification integrates game-design elements into non-game contexts, especially online gambling, aiming to enhance user engagement and prolong play sessions. This strategy aligns with psychological principles—such as dopamine-driven reward systems—yet it must be implemented judiciously to uphold responsible gaming standards.
